Score 90/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, Mar 2004

Medium red. Slightly high-toned aromas of cherry, plum and minerals. Rich, dense, broad and deep, with flavors of red fruits and smoke. Finishes with rich tannins and excellent length. This has turned out well.

Score 87+/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ous

(less than halfway through its malo) Medium red. Spice and game dominate the nose. Fat and spicy, with softish acids and red berry flavors. A bit less vibrant than the Gevrey villages, and a tad dry on the end. Hard to assess at this stage.

Domaine Fourrier

Domaine Fourrier is located in the village of Gevrey-Chambertin. The estate has been run by Jean-Marie Fourrier since 1994, and has rapidly become one of the village’s most fashionable names, known for producing pure and transparent Pinot Noir.
